Step-by-Step Instructions
- Begin by cleaning the mushrooms under cool running water, gently scrubbing to remove dirt. Pat them dry with a paper towel, then slice into uniform pieces, about a quarter-inch thick.
- In a large skillet, heat over medium until warm, then add 2 tablespoons of butter. Allow to melt completely, stirring occasionally until it begins to bubble.
- Stir in 2 cloves of minced gar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
- Add the sliced mushrooms to the skillet. Stir gently, allowing them to absorb the buttery garlic flavor and cook for 10–15 minutes.
- Sprinkle in thyme, cayenne pepper, salt, and pepper. Gently stir to combine and cook for an additional 2 minutes.
- Transfer the Cowboy Mushrooms to a serving dish and serve warm.
